The Clinical Documentation Improvement Clinical Data Analyst collaborates with HIM Coding and Clinical Documentation Improvement staff to facilitate discussion of difficult cases, as well as perform second level pre-bill reviews to ensure appropriate clinical severity is captured to support the patient’s level of care and appropriate assignment of the DRG for all payers. Findings and data in the CDI review process shall be shared with the Medical Staff and multi-disciplinary teams for continued education and Clinical Documentation Improvement development efforts.
